This discipline meets both science and philosophy on controversial grounds. It takes personal experience as well as mental sharpness to combine these branches of knowledge that are likely to generate sympathy and acceptance.

Let’s put it in plain English – Each person responds/reacts differently to the same situation. PI has a massive role in developing a mindset, which serves as an engine for perceiving the world and then conducting in-depth processing of the data collected through the senses.

PI can be subdivided into two aspects:

    • Perception
  • Interpretation.

Here’s how the process is set in motion: As we mentioned, through the senses (consisting of receptor cells), a person perceives the outer world or the worldly sensations.

Afterward, the information gathered is transformed into some kind of “electrochemical signal,” which is then passed on to the brain.

To streamline this process, we have unconsciously developed mental concepts, to process the information much quicker.

In other words, when a certain electrochemical signal arrives at the desired destination, the brain already has a reaction in place, without diving into too much evaluation.

Scarcity is undoubtedly affecting and influencing the level of your PI. For instance, you so badly want to buy a new car, but you don’t have any money.

This exaggerates the value of the vehicle, by making it look more appealing, majestic and impressive. Or, if you are not given access to a certain area, that makes you even more eager to look behind that door.

Remember Dee Dee, from Dexter’s laboratory – well it’s the same thing. If something is prohibited, it makes us wonder what would happen if we don’t follow the rules.
